With the pretty River Erme flowing from the moors through the middle of the town, Ivybridge is family-orientated with a rich heritage of traditional industries such as milling and cloth making that are still celebrated today. As well as its fascinating history, Ivybridge offers adventure. The idyllic countryside and moorland offer miles of magnificent walking trails out of the town, whilst in the town itself you’ll find pubs, eateries and a variety of shops and supermarkets. The property sits within walking distance of the town centre. There is a good choice of primary schools all within the catchment of the renowned Ivybridge Community College with its World Class Quality Mark Award. There are several places of worship with noteworthy histories, GP and Dental Surgeries, a Minor Injuries Unit, two leisure centres with swimming pools, fitness suites, and various health classes. There is also the charming Watermark with its welcoming library, IT suite, cinema, theatre, coffee shop and conference facilities. If golf is your escape, then there is the 18-hole course at nearby Wrangaton set against the backdrop of the beautiful Ugborough Beacon. There are also the ever-popular Ivybridge Rugby, Football, Cricket, and Tennis clubs all adding to the community focus of the town and with its very own train station there are excellent transport links to Plymouth, Exeter, and London; Ivybridge certainly has a wealth of opportunities to welcome you.
